Brand New Lower Unit!


Aftermarket Replacement Lower Unit For Mercruiser Alpha One Generation II Outdrive

  • Fits Alpha Gen II Units 1991 - Now
  •  Fits drive with ratio of 1.94,1.81,1.62 & 1.47
  • Not to be use with ratio 2.00 & 2.40 upper unit
  •  Be sure that your drive is a Gen II built after 1991 before ordering.
  • These units have a three year fault free manufacturer warranty, if anything happens to it within three years its covered by the manufacturer- Low or no oil, physical damage, anything except theft is covered!
  • These units are rated and warrantied up to 300 horsepower

CDN announces finalists for Car Design Awards China 2010

Tue, 13 Apr 2010

阅读本文中文版本请点击这里 CDN is pleased to reveal the finalists for its inaugural Car Design Awards which will be presented at a prestigious ceremony on 21 April in Beijing prior to Auto China. The competition aims to inspire and develop the creative talent of China's students and assist them on the road to becoming professional automotive designers. Concept Car of the Week: Heuliez H4 (1972)

Fri, 21 Jun 2013

With the H4, Heuliez set out into unexplored territories by offering a concept tailored to the needs of taxi drivers. If today's minivans are an integral part of our daily lives, this Peugeot 204-based H4 should be placed back in its original context in the early ‘70s, when this monovolume architecture still belonged to science fiction. Its dimensions are comparable to a Renault Modus although it's shortened by 140mm.

New Land Rover Discovery Sport to get 7 seats – and they’re (almost) revealed

Tue, 29 Jul 2014

The Land Rover Discovery Sport shows it 7-seat layout We already know that the Land Rover Discovery Sport will be replacing the Freelander in Land Rover’s range next year as the first in a family of Discovery models from Land Rover. It seemed likely that the new Discovery Sport would come with five seats as standard but with as even seat option to add another dimension, but Land Rover has decided it is going to offer 7 seats as standard, setting it apart from the competition in the ‘Premium’ sector. Land Rover are busy running prototypes of the new Discovery Sport, and to ram home the point that the new Discovery Sport is more flexible than its competition they’ve covered it in camouflage that looks like the skin of the car has been peeled back to show the 7-seat (well, 5+2) arrangement inside.
